We are seeking a dedicated and compassionate Social Worker to join an All‑Age Disability (0-25) service. This role supports children, young people, and young adults with disabilities that significantly impact their daily lives. You will work closely with individuals and families to identify needs, develop outcome‑focused plans, and ensure a smooth transition through different stages of life. This is a fantastic opportunity to make a meaningful difference while working within a supportive, multi‑disciplinary environment.
Key Responsibilities
- Work in partnership with children, young people, young adults, and their families to assess needs and develop tailored social care plans.
- Safeguard vulnerable individuals and promote their wellbeing through high‑quality, person‑centred practice.
- Complete statutory assessments in line with legislation and organisational procedures.
- Coordinate services and resources to achieve the best outcomes.
- Maintain accurate, confidential case records and contribute to multi‑agency partnership working.
- Participate in regular supervision and ongoing professional development.
Essential Requirements
- Qualified Social Worker with Social Work England registration.
- Experience working with children, young people or young adults in a statutory social care environment.
- Strong safeguarding knowledge and decision‑making experience.
- Excellent communication, assessment, and report‑writing skills.
- Ability to manage a varied caseload and prioritise effectively.
- Strong partnership‑working and multi‑agency coordination skills.
- Ability to travel across the region as required.
Desirable Experience
- Experience supporting individuals with disabilities and complex needs.
- Experience undertaking safeguarding investigations (child or adult).
- Knowledge of preparation for adulthood pathways.
